React
GASG2021
这个作者很懒,什么都没留下…
展开
-
从零开始学习ReactJS -- 05 --路由拦截与监听好麻烦,但是必须要有!
从零开始学习ReactJS – 05 --路由拦截与监听好麻烦,但是必须要有!路由拦截与监听路由拦截与监听对于一个项目来讲基本是必须要有的,因为只要涉及到登录权限等问题就需要这些功能了,需要将未登录的时候都拦截在登录界面,没有权限的都丢到无权限页面去。麻烦对于VUE来讲, vue-router提供了路由守卫的API方法来让我们非常方便的进行路由监听与拦截处理了,但是我找了好久也没有找到ReactJS相关的API方法,大部分都是一句话:ReactJS的所有东西都是组件,所以只要通过组件的方法来进行实现原创 2020-10-16 16:37:21 · 186 阅读 · 0 评论 -
从零开始学习ReactJS -- 04 --提取路由配置,都放在一起像什么样子!
从零开始学习ReactJS – 04 --提取路由配置,都放在一起像什么样子!提取出路由的配置便于维护上代码 改造src/router/index.jsimport React from 'react'import {BrowserRouter as Router, Route, Link, Switch } from 'react-router-dom'import routes from './route'class IRouter extends React.Component{原创 2020-10-16 16:36:59 · 121 阅读 · 0 评论 -
从零开始学习ReactJS -- 03 -- 路由嵌套必须的学啊!
从零开始学习ReactJS – 03 – 路由嵌套必须的学啊!路由嵌套配置路由嵌套是非常常用的配置,例如管理后台中,对于很多内容页面都是在同一个框架下,一般都是首页包含了头部、侧导航、底部信息等内容,然后在首页中间进行嵌套功能页面,这样达到了复用与开发上的便利开始配置上代码 改造了 src/router/index.jsimport React from 'react'import Loadable from 'react-loadable'import {BrowserRouter as R原创 2020-10-16 16:36:27 · 123 阅读 · 0 评论 -
从零开始学习ReactJS -- 02 -- 然后要把路由配置起来才能区分页面啊!
从零开始学习React - 02学习路由配置查询度娘, react的路由配置有且仅有一种 react-router 、 react-router-dom经过比较,觉得react-router-dom 更好一些,所以使用react-router-dom安装react-router-domnpm install react-router-dom执行完成后安装完成开始配置我没有找到react-router-dom的中文官方文档,只能拼凑这看教程来进行学习单独在src下建立router文件夹进行原创 2020-10-16 16:36:00 · 104 阅读 · 0 评论 -
从零开始学习ReactJS -- 01 --首先要搭建一个react项目啊!
从头开始学习ReactJS - 01开始学习第一步看文档文档地址:https://react.docschina.org/docs/getting-started.html主要介绍了ReactJS的基本内容与基本语法开始按照文档进行搭建npx create-react-app my-app #my-app 是项目名称 自己定义 下同cd my-appnpm start执行成功后显示页面编辑器打开代码查看内容使用vscode编辑器打开项目 项目目录结构显示入口文件 src/原创 2020-10-16 16:35:28 · 128 阅读 · 0 评论